**TICKET: Sig check failing on SockWeld reconnect patch**

Build 4417 of the SockWeld reconnect fix fails signature verification in the Tarnow pipeline. Patch addresses the reconnect storm on dropped heartbeats; code is ready, deploy is blocked. Verifier reports signer mismatch — the hotfix was signed on the backup Quillen host, which carries a stale keyring. Do not bypass verification. Re-sign on a host with the current keyring, or update the stale host. The current trusted signing key is below.

rollout seal: bky4_x7Gc

Subject: Sort stability fix in Pellgrove report builder

Future maintainers: the grouped-export path used an unstable sort, so rows with equal keys reshuffled between runs and broke diff-based QA. Fixed by switching to a stable merge sort and adding a tiebreaker on row ingest order. Do not "optimize" this back to the old comparator; the tests in report_sort_spec encode the guarantee. Shipping in tonight's cut. The fixed build is identified by the token below.

trace token, kajeg-bajop: htk6_46382d

Reviewer notes for Calcyon's formula sandbox: all user-supplied formulas run inside the Fernbox interpreter with no filesystem, network, or reflection access. Check that any new builtin is registered through the capability table, not imported directly. Budget limits (50ms CPU, 4MB heap) are enforced per evaluation. If you need to inspect a quarantined formula locally, unlock the review sandbox with the recovery passphrase provided below.

unlock words, hahip-baduf: holwyn-istath-julvan

### Action Item 4: Cap prefetch fan-out in TrailSketch tiles

During the incident, the map-tile prefetcher happily fetched three zoom levels in every direction whenever a plugin panned programmatically, which is how we melted the tile cache. If your plugin drives the viewport, please batch your pan calls — the prefetcher now debounces them, but it's still polite to help. We're shipping hard caps in the next SDK release. The new defaults are as follows.

limits module of fajog-tawig:
RATE_LIMITS = {
    "druwyn": 2,
    "quenael": 10,
    "wenix": 2,
    "druael": 2,
}